Understanding Technological Innovation
Technological innovation refers to the process of developing new technologies or improving existing ones to enhance efficiency, effectiveness, and overall performance. This phenomenon is a driving force behind economic growth, productivity enhancement, and the improvement of living standards worldwide.

Types of Technological Innovations
Technological innovations can be categorized into several types, including:
- Incremental Innovation: Improvements made to existing products or processes, focusing on efficiency and cost reduction.
- Disruptive Innovation: New technologies that create a new market and value network, displacing established products and services.
- Radical Innovation: A groundbreaking development that significantly alters industries and leads to new market creation.
Examples of Technological Innovation
Recent advancements showcase the power of technological innovation:
- Artificial Intelligence (AI): Machine learning and deep learning technologies have transformed various sectors, from healthcare to finance, with capabilities like predictive analytics and personalized customer experiences.
- Blockchain Technology: Originally designed for cryptocurrencies, blockchain has expanded into industries such as supply chain management and healthcare, enhancing security and transparency.
- Telemedicine: The rise of telehealth services has revolutionized access to healthcare, allowing patients to consult with medical professionals remotely, especially vital during global health crises.
Challenges of Technological Innovation
Despite its benefits, technological innovation comes with challenges. Organizations must navigate issues such as intellectual property rights, high development costs, and the need for skilled labor. Furthermore, rapid advancements can lead to ethical dilemmas, particularly in areas like data privacy and automation.
